heh, porco that was you. Of course this is not DVDShrink, it's untouched, also doesn't smell like DVDShrink to me.
Facts that speak for this version being r-rated:
- there is no indication anywhere in the menu that tells this version is the UNRATED. We know from other movies like White Chicks that the menus are usually plastered with the term UNRATED.
- the length of this version is 88 minute, unrated is supposed to be 90 minutes (however, these total length info you find in press releases is not always correct)
- can't find the music video extra (checked all menus with menuedit)
Facts that speak for this version being unrated:
- Even after timecode conversion the CORRuPT R1 version is 1 minute longer than the PAL one, why? Could be different cut for the US master and European master (like Spiderman 2, and others) but also could also be the difference R-rated/Un-rated
- someone here posted he's seen scenes that were not in the theatre (could have not remembered them though...)
- the "Extreme" commentary track that's supposed to be only on the unrated version is/was on this disc (checked menu with menuedit)
I guess unless someone can confirm this by having either retail r1 version of this movie or the group releases some nfofix with proof or whatever, we can't tell 100% what version this is, hehe.
